Last Comix Standing Season 5 Finalists Announced

Competitions Sept. 13, 20 and 27-- Finalists Compete October 4
By: Comix at Foxwoods
 
MASHANTUCKET, Conn. - Sept. 1, 2015 - PRLog -- Comix at Foxwoods proudly presents the semi-finals of its perennial stand-up competition, "Last Comix Standing," which begins Sunday, September 13 at 8:00 p.m. and showcases some of the top comedic talent throughout the Northeast taking center stage with an eye on the prize: the Last Comix Standing title.

The three-month competition began on July 26 with 120 of the region's funniest comedians. The competition has been chopped to 42 quarter-finalists and now 12 semi-finalists who will be judged for their on-stage presence, originality, and crowd reaction.

Only three comics (one from each semi-finalist group) will make it to the final round on Sunday, October 4 for a head-to-head face-off that will feature 25-minute sets from each performer. The winner will take home $1,500, a week’s worth of shows including headline spots and opening for a national headliner at Comix at Foxwoods, a photo on the Comix Wall of Fame and the title "Last Comix Standing."

This year's semi-finalists and competition performance dates include:

Sunday, September 13: Drew Dunn (Nashua, NH), Roman Pierce (Franklin, MA), Tom Stewart (Cranston, RI) and Pat Oates (Ansonia, CT)

Sunday, September 20: Corey Manning (Norwood, MA), Justin Hoff (Medford, MA), Jarwan Nelson (Cortland, NY) and James Dorsey (Auburn, MA)

Sunday, September 27: Brian Plumb (Longmeadow, MA), Brian Herberger (Buffalo, NY), Matt Barry (Hudson, NH) and Kenny Garcia (New York, NY)

Drew Dunn (Nashua, NH): Drew is a comic from NH that performs all over Boston and greater New England. His unique use of voices while telling stories of life in a big family and experiences keep audiences laughing and wanting more!

Pat Oates (Ansonia, CT):  Born and raised in CT, Pat Oates has unique and hilarious outlook on life. His quick wit and blunt story telling has made him a crowd favorite all over New England.

Roman Pierce (Franklin, MA): Roman won the stand-up comedy competition at the 2009 Rhode Island Comedy Festival. He has been featured on Fox, MYTV, and NBC's Last Comic Standing: Too Hot for Primetime.

Tom Stewart (Cranston, RI): After 20 years of working on radio and television, Tom has taken his comedic voice to the stage and quickly become one of New England's hardest working comedians.

Corey Manning (Norwood, MA): Take a seat and put you drinks/food in location where you're less likely to knock them over, because as soon as Corey Manning descends upon the stage... It's on!!!

Jarwan Nelson (Medford, MA): When not on a stage having the time of his life, Jarwan can be found drinking protein. During pre and post protein drinking, Jarwan is most likely taping a comedic sketch for his weekly social media comedy show Hood Classy or perhaps running wind sprints in hopes of being fast enough to one day catch his dreams.

James Dorsey (Auburn, MA): James’ performance on stage has been described as “Flawless, smooth and original. A born professional.” James has shared the stage with Patrice O’Neal, Gilbert Gottfried, Billy Gardell, Lenny Clarke, Gary Gullman, Jimmy Dunn, Don Gavin, Steve Sweeney, Bryan Callen and Steven Wright.

Justin Hoff (Medford, MA): Justin Hoff is quickly becoming a staple in the Boston comedy scene. Winner of the 2014 "Funniest New Comic on the East Coast" contest at Mohegan Sun.

Brian Plumb (Longmeadow, MA): Brian Plumb's confrontational and abrasive style has made him a favorite in clubs across the northeast.

Brian Herberger (Buffalo, NY): Drawing on his checkered past, his 7 years working as a middle school teacher, and embarrassing escapades on the dating scene, Brian brings his personal, relatable experiences to the stage.

Matt Barry (Hudson, NY): Matt Barry is one of New England’s fastest rising stars in comedy. A mischievous, post-grad stoner, Matt’s act centers around a transition into adulthood he isn’t ready to make.

Kenny Garcia (New York, NY): Growing up in the Lower East Side of Manhattan when it was still considered a tough place to live, Kenny used his humor to navigate his way through childhood. A natural storyteller, he will take you on a fun ride with stories of raising a little girl and some of life's unimportant things.
